msco, I too am still wrestling with RAID problems. I have a similar system without all the drives. I did many back and forth with both ASRock and AMD Technical Support. Please open a ticket with AMD and point to this thread. I suspect Matt will recognize me. I also could not get rid of my Phantom drives. I call them ghost and I even had a RAID0 ghost. I RMAed my board and just got it back a few days ago. I have not tried to create an array but looked (wish I had NOT) at RAIDXpert2 (RX2) in BIOS and see that I still have my ghost drives and RAID0. When I get brave, I have one more thing to try. I will unplug my two HDs and either secure erase or -Diskpart, Clean All- my SSDs and see if I can create a RAID0 from all three of my SSDs. At this point I do not have a lot of advice for you, but some requests. Please post your specifications in your signature including versions of W10 and BIOS. Be sure to always initialize your drives and arrays in GPT. That may be why you are getting "may not support booting". When you talk about RX2, please say Windows or BIOS version. I think this is an example of a simple bad decision naming these two the same. How are you installing W10 - USB? Please do open an AMD ticket to help convince them this RAID function is broken and very poorly documented. ASRock Technical Support essentially gave up on me, insisting I RMA the MB. I think AMD is our only hope and since they designed the function will need to fix it anyway. Several users have created simple RAIDs here with no problems, but if you get off the main path, bad things seem to happen. I am glad you posted, maybe we can get something accomplished. Your last comment, "live with for now..." may be our end results. Thanks and enjoy, John.

Having a hard time with RAIDxpert2 and this build. Below is my post that I have over on the AMD forums looking for some advice.
I have a new 1950x build with an Asrock x399 Fata1ity MB and Windows 10 Pro. I tried following the RAID setup instructions here https://community.amd.com/external-link.jspa?url=https%3A%2F%2Fwww.asrock.com%2FMB%2FAMD%2FFatal1ty%2520X399%2520Professional%2520Gaming%2Findex.asp%23Manual I have 3 M2 NVMe drives - one for a stand-alone boot disk and 2 for a RAID 0 Cache disk. Also 4 other 1TB SSD's for a work RAID 0 and a couple other various standard HDDs for backups, etc. If I follow their guide I can not install Windows - at install it gives me an error that it cannot install to the drive because my hardware may not support booting to it, ensure the controller is enabled in BIOS - this is after manually installing the RAID drivers to see the disks per the guide.
The only way I've gotten the m2 boot disk to install windows is do it under AHCI, then switch to RAID in the BIOS - which converts that disk to a "Legacy", which works fine. I should also note I have to leave NVMe RAID mode disabled to boot - with it enabled it won't boot from the NVMe drive windows is installed on. I can still build a RAID with the other 2 NVMe drives in Windows though - but not BIOS. Everything functions fine, except I get this a 1016 CRITICAL error that I have Arrays that are offline. These are phantom LEGACY 1tb drives that do not exist, I believe they are some phantom duplicate of my boot disk (m.2 1tb SSD). Sometimes it's one, sometimes it's 3. I delete them with RAIDxpert2 every time but they always re-populate on start up. I've deleted them in BIOS also and they always show back up.
I've done a clean BIOS flash, clean Windows 10 install multiple times, the above sequence/settings is the only thing I've gotten to work and phantom drives just keeps coming back every time. Any advice would be appreciated but I'm guessing it might just be a bug I have to live with for now... Thanks for any advice! |
